The first 60 seconds: getting control of the scene
Walk up, take a breath out, and scan. I'm not being poetic, I'm setting your brain. A deep breath causes a small decrease in your own adrenaline, which assists you see the entire image instead of tunnel vision. Look for threat to you and to the wounded person: website traffic drift, a live source of power, broken glass, a canine with bristling hair. If you're not risk-free, you're not helpful.
Once the location is secure, introduce on your own and get approval if they're awake. People comply when they hear proficiency, so keep it easy: "I'm learnt first aid. I'm going to assist you. What's your name?" That's also your initial awareness check.
If another person is about, recruit instantly. Provide clear work with names: "Sam, phone call three-way absolutely no and request for an ambulance. Return with the driver on audio speaker." Delegation lowers spectator freeze and speeds up your next steps.

The key study that in fact conserves lives
The main study's objective is not to detect, it's to locate and fix the awesomes initially. Maintain it linear and quick. For adults and older youngsters, utilize a DRSABCD strategy:

- Danger: currently cleared. Response: speak to them, touch the shoulder. Send for help: call or appoint the call early if there's any doubt. Airway: look in the mouth, turn the head a little, lift the chin. Eliminate evident obstruction if you can see it. Breathing: look, pay attention, really feel for as much as 10 secs. If not taking a breath or wheezing, treat as not breathing. CPR: start compressions if not breathing normally. Defibrillation: attach an AED as soon as it gets here and follow its prompts.

CPR that operates in the actual world
People hesitate on deepness. They stress over damaging ribs. Ribs can recover. The mind can't make it through long without oxygen. For adults, go for 5 to 6 centimeters deepness at a price of 100 to 120 compressions per minute. A track beat helps if it's already in your head, yet I choose a watch or the AED metronome when readily available. Ensure complete upper body recoil between compressions. Reduce stops. If you're alone and do not feel confident with breaths, do compression‑only CPR until help arrives.
A quick note on breaths when educated and eager: after 30 compressions, offer 2 breaths. Seal the nose, turn the head, lift the chin, and deliver each breath over one second looking for chest rise. If you do not see upper body rise, reassess the head tilt and seal. Don't overventilate. Air in the stomach raises regurgitation risk.
For babies and youngsters, depth is one third of the upper body's anterior‑posterior diameter. Method changes with dimension: two fingers for babies, 1 or 2 hands for youngsters. An AED is not optional in a heart attack, it's the most effective chance at a practical rhythm. In shopping centers and area locations around Miranda, you'll locate AEDs near customer support desks and gym entries. Open the lid and adhere to the voice motivates. Cutting extreme breast hair where pads go improves call, and wiping sweat aids adhesion. Do not worry about precise pad proportion, worry they are securely stuck on the top right chest and lower left side. Clear the individual prior to evaluation and shock.
Choking: crucial actions in a compressed timeline
Choking doesn't offer you ten mins. It provides you seconds to a couple of minutes. If they're coughing powerfully and making noise, urge coughing and monitor. If they can't cough or talk, act.
For adults and youngsters over one year, deliver up to five firm back blows in between the shoulder blades while they lean ahead. If that fails, change to stomach drives, in some cases called the Heimlich maneuver: support them, make a fist above the navel, order the fist with your other hand, and draw inward and higher dramatically. Alternative back impacts and thrusts till the things clears or they collapse. Once they become less competent, move to the ground and start mouth-to-mouth resuscitation. Examine the mouth for visible obstruction prior to breaths, but no blind sweeps.
For infants, support the head and neck, supply 5 back penalizes the baby angled head‑down on your lower arm, then transform them to their back and offer 5 chest drives with two fingers on the breast bone. Repeat as required. Training brings confidence here. Bleeding: control defeats cleverness
I have actually seen individuals fuss with small plasters while blood swimming pools. Stress is king. Apply straight pressure with your hand over a dressing or whatever clean towel is available. Elevation assists yet is secondary. If hemorrhaging soaks with, include more layers and press harder, do not remove the original dressing. For extreme arm or leg blood loss that does not respond to direct stress, a tourniquet can be life‑saving. Setting it 5 to 7 centimeters over the injury, prevent joints, tighten up up until bleeding quits, and note the moment. When the breast is limited: asthma and anaphylaxis
Asthma flares prevail on cold early mornings and throughout viral periods. One of the most vital piece of equipment is a reliever inhaler with a spacer. Shake the flatterer, insert into the spacer, secure the mouth, and provide one puff followed by 4 to 6 breaths. Repeat with one smoke each time. In modest to severe asthma, 4 to 12 smokes spaced regarding a min apart can be utilized over 20 mins, after that evaluation. If there's no renovation or the person battles to speak, call a rescue. Sitting upright assists more than lying flat.
Anaphylaxis intensifies quickly. The rule is adrenaline first, ambulance second, antihistamines nowhere in the choice tree for the very first minutes. If you have an adrenaline autoinjector, provide it right into the external upper leg via clothing if required, and note the moment. Maintain the individual relaxing with legs flat unless they're struggling to breathe, in which situation sitting with legs out is acceptable. If they boost and then intensify, a second dose after five mins can be appropriate. Head knocks, necks, and menstruation of false reassurance
A person that stands up and says they're great after a head knock is not a diagnosis. They might be great. They may have a concussion, which can look like irritability, migraine, queasiness, or just a foggy hold-up in solutions. Screens in sports learn to search for refined adjustments. If unsure, remainder them, observe for 2 hours, and avoid choices that call for full concentration. Throwing up greater than when, worsening headache, complication, weak point, or any type of loss of awareness gains a medical assessment.
Suspected back injuries are rare outside high‑energy effects, yet early bad moves can create injury. If a loss from height, a strong take on, or a roadway incident is involved, ask about neck discomfort, tingling, or weakness. If they're aware and secure, ask to continue to be still, place your hands on either side of the head to remind them, and await experienced aid. Don't use collars unless educated and the setting needs it. If they vomit or air passage comes to be jeopardized, prioritize respiratory tract also if it implies rolling them with a careful log‑roll strategy. Great training educates the judgment to break immobilization when breathing is at risk.
Burns: cool down the shed, not the patient
A negative burn looks significant, and the impulse is to do something intricate. You don't require elaborate. Amazing running water over the burn for 20 mins within the first three hours lowers cells damages and pain. Stay clear of ice. Remove precious jewelry and tight clothes early prior to swelling sets in. If clothes is stuck, do not draw it off. Cover the cooled down shed with a non‑stick dressing or clean stick movie positioned freely. Chemical burns require extra care: reject completely dry powders before washing, and secure yourself. Electrical burns conceal much deeper injury, so keep a low limit for clinical review.

Face, hands, feet, groin, and circumferential burns should have immediate assessment even if tiny. With youngsters, a sprinkle of hot tea can cover 10 percent of body area in a blink. Fractures, strains, and what you can do with a triangular bandage
You do not require an orthopedist's eye to deal with the very first half hour. Assistance and debilitate in the setting located if activity enhances discomfort or creates deformity. A padded splint or improvised assistance from a folded up magazine still belongs. For ankle joints and wrists without evident defect, RICER concepts hold: remainder, ice, compression, elevation, and recommendation if pain continues or weight‑bearing is difficult. Ice in 15 to 20 min windows with a fabric barrier protects against cold injury.
Triangular bandages look old‑fashioned until you need to sling an arm quickly. A comfortable sling decreases pain and movement, and it buys time. Tightness is your adversary. If fingers prickle, look pale, or feel chilly, loosen up and reassess.
Heat, cool, and the exterior curveballs
On hot days, warmth exhaustion sneaks up during events and worksites. Early indicators include hefty sweating, headache, nausea or vomiting, and irritability. Transfer to color, loosen up clothing, and provide tiny sips of water or oral rehydration option. If complication develops, or they quit sweating and really feel hot and dry, that's heat stroke. That is a medical emergency situation. Amazing aggressively with chilly damp towels, followers, or an ice bathroom if readily available, while waiting on help.
Hypothermia in metropolitan setups typically adheres to immersion or direct exposure after alcohol. Early shuddering is excellent, it indicates the body is still battling. Replace damp clothes, wrap in layers, and handle delicately. Fast rewarming of hands and feet can be excruciating and dangerous; focus on the trunk first.
The psychology of the very first aider
Your manner often alters the end result. I've seen panicked patients calm down when someone stoops to their eye level and utilizes their name. I've also seen well‑meaning assistants escalate worry by narrating every sign they discover. Speak much less than you think, and keep your tone neutral. Avoid encouraging end results. Rather, offer certainty in process: "We're mosting likely to maintain you breathing and comfortable. The rescue gets on the means."
Bystander administration matters also. A crowd can end up being a danger or a resource. Appoint tasks: fetch the AED, direct web traffic, meet paramedics at the road, watch the clock. If somebody is filming, ask to go back or, if suitable, to use their phone for the emergency situation phone call and put it on audio speaker next to you. Lots of people wish to assist, they just require direction.

Edge situations that catch individuals out
- Drowning and near‑drowning: focus on rescue breathing as early as feasible if educated and risk-free to do so. Hypoxia is the primary trouble. Get rid of the person from the water with back caution if a dive was entailed, yet don't delay breathing assistance for long immobilization attempts in the water. Seizures: don't limit. Safeguard the head with something soft, clear the area, and time the event. If the seizure lasts greater than five mins, or there are repeated seizures without full healing, call an ambulance. Later, put them on their side when safe, and anticipate confusion. Diabetes: reduced blood glucose offers with sweating, shaking, confusion, and occasionally aggressiveness. If they can swallow, provide quick sugar like glucose gel, juice, or jelly beans, after that follow with a longer‑acting carbohydrate. If they're drowsy or can not ingest, do not offer dental intake. Call for help. Poisoning: don't cause throwing up. Accumulate information about the compound and time, and call the Poisons Details Centre for advice while emergency situation solutions are en route if serious signs develop.
